Output 031b80daea7b41b1f54b030b2777068b1922051e275ec9eabd29f552a364e328:6

value
1241382
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d5bd0b81238d66bf5e8c2a664c071f6f5afb2304 OP_EQUALVERIFY OP_CHECKSIG
address
1LV9Pw63BEyshksjHoX2AEC1L2Cd2yr6EM
transaction
031b80daea7b41b1f54b030b2777068b1922051e275ec9eabd29f552a364e328
confirmations
542865
spent
true